The
Short Everest View Trek is a perfect
introduction to the stunning landscapes and vibrant culture of the Everest
region for those with limited time. This 5-day
trek offers an excellent opportunity to experience the breathtaking beauty
of the Himalayas, including the iconic Mount
Everest. Starting and ending in Kathmandu, the journey encompasses a
thrilling flight to Lukla, the bustling Sherpa town of Namche Bazaar, and
spectacular views from the Everest View Hotel 3800 m. Along the way, trekkers will
encounter picturesque villages, ancient monasteries, and the warm hospitality
of the Sherpa people. This trek is ideal for adventurers seeking a quick yet
fulfilling glimpse of the Everest region's splendor.

An early morning transfer will take you to the airport for a scenic flight to Lukla, perched at an altitude of 2,860 meters. The 30-minute flight offers breathtaking views of the Himalayas. Upon landing, you will meet your trekking crew and start the trek towards Phakding, situated at 2,610 meters. The trail descends through the Dudh Koshi River valley, passing by traditional Sherpa villages, lush forests, and prayer wheels. After approximately 3-4 hours of trekking, you will reach Phakding. Overnight accommodation will be in a cozy lodge.
After breakfast, the trek from Phakding to Namche Bazaar begins. The route involves crossing several suspension bridges, including the famous Hillary Suspension Bridge, and walking through pine forests with glimpses of distant snow-capped peaks. As you ascend, you will pass through the villages of Monjo and Jorsale before entering Sagarmatha National Park. The trail then steeply climbs towards Namche Bazaar, a bustling market town at 3,440 meters, known as the gateway to Everest. The trek takes about 5-6 hours, and upon arrival, you will check into a guesthouse for the night.
Today is an acclimatization day to help your body adjust to the altitude. In the morning, you will hike to the Everest View Hotel, which offers panoramic views of Mount Everest, Lhotse, Ama Dablam, and other majestic peaks. This short hike is approximately 2-3 hours and provides excellent photo opportunities. After enjoying the views, you will return to Namche Bazaar. The afternoon is free for you to explore Namche, visit the Sherpa Museum, or simply relax. Overnight stay will be at the same guesthouse.
On
the final day of trekking, you will retrace your steps back to Lukla. The
descent is easier and takes about 6-7 hours, covering a distance of approximately
19 kilometers. You will pass through the same beautiful landscapes and
villages, bidding farewell to the serene mountains. You can enjoy farewell with your trekking crew, this day is the final day of your trek at Lukla. Say bye to your porter sherpa.
Your guide will assist you in dropping you off at the airport for the Kathmandu flight. The flight takes 45 minutes. Once you reach Kathmandu airport, one of the officials from Local travel company ( Discover Altitude) will pick you up and drop you off at your respective hotel.
